善人おっさん、生まれ変わったらSSSランク人生が確定した
Original Japanese Title
Also known as: As a Virtuous Middle-Aged Man, My New Life Was Confirmed to Be SSS Rank, Zennin Ossan, Umarekawattara SSS-Rank Jinsei ga Kakutei shita, 善人おっさん、生まれ変わったらSSSランク人生が確定した
This world judges the deeds and good karma of your previous life, and grants you a rank when you are reborn. The benevolent man, even surprising the heavenly beings through this, decides to be reborn as the son Alexander of a noble family, and thus starts his SSS-Rank life! Follow Alec’s journey as he lives his life as a SSS Rank!

## My Thoughts on Virtuous Old Man, SSS-Rank is Confirmed in Your Next Life
### First Impressions
Okay, so "Virtuous Old Man, SSS-Rank is Confirmed in Your Next Life" certainly has a title that grabs your attention. The premise, an overpowered child reincarnation story, definitely piqued my interest. I went in expecting a fun, lighthearted romp through a fantasy world with a protagonist who's basically a saint in a toddler's body. While some aspects hit that mark, others, unfortunately, didn't quite land for me.
### What Works Well
There's a certain charm to the protagonist's unwavering commitment to his virtuous nature. It's refreshing to see a character stick to their beliefs, even when faced with the temptations and challenges of a new life. I found the slice-of-life elements enjoyable, and the pacing generally kept me engaged. The romance aspect, while not a central focus, was also handled reasonably well. I appreciate that the story avoids the typical harem route, with the MC choosing a wife and having a lover.
### Areas of Concern
However, I did find some aspects of the story less compelling. The core issue, for me, stems from the believability of the premise. While I'm generally willing to suspend my disbelief for fantasy stories, some plot points felt a bit too far-fetched. The humor didn't always hit the mark, and there were moments where the narrative felt like it was trying too hard to be quirky.
### ⚠️ Spoiler Warning
Alright, let's get into some spoiler territory. The whole plotline with the creator god wanting to eliminate the MC due to his potential power in future lives felt a bit convoluted. I also struggled with the "virtuous deeds backfiring" scenario. The idea that the MC's attempts to help others ultimately disrupt the balance of the world is intriguing, but the execution felt somewhat flawed. It introduces a potential plot hole where the MC's good intentions lead to negative consequences, which undermines his character.
### Final Verdict
Overall, "Virtuous Old Man, SSS-Rank is Confirmed in Your Next Life" is a mixed bag. While it offers a heartwarming and enjoyable slice-of-life experience with a genuinely virtuous protagonist, it struggles with believability and some questionable plot developments. I'd say it's worth a read if you're looking for a lighthearted fantasy with a unique premise, but be prepared to overlook some of its shortcomings. I'd give it a tentative 3 out of 5 stars.
